A nice easy going comedy.
1 November 2007
This starts of with quite a few good laughs some visual, some slapstick and a few situation based but gets a little more serious as it progresses.

The acting is good with Rooney as the slightly mad client being especially good and Caine is his usual self in the lead.

The one liners are delivered well and the occasional difference between what is narrated and what is acted out is amusing.

The plot is a little thin and when it gets serious it doesn't do it too well.

It's a watchable film with no bad bits and a few good ones but it's nothing special.
